Ooh-ooh! Count me two! My first fretless was a late-70s Frankenbass, mostly Fender - a Precision body w/a Jazz pup added and a defretted Jazz (fretlines filled w/black epoxy) neck. Eventually the neck succumbed and could no longer maintain decent posture, so the bass got an MM fretless precision neck - which I hate. 2 years ago I bought a 4-string ('88) Buzz and last month got a ('94) Pentabuzz, my first 5-string. Here is my G&L SB-2, it is about 1 1/2 years old and the build and finish are amazing. The SB-2's are my favorite playing 4-string basses I have ever owned and this one certainly has not let me down.

This is one of the first SB-2's that where made with the new 6-bolt neck design, it seems to have a bit better sustain then my other SB-2's that I have.

Here they are, my pride and joy
Fodera NYC Empire Basses

First one is:
Alder Body with Spalted Maple Top
Maple Neck Ebony Fingerboard with Purpleheart Lines
Lane Poor NYC Pickups with a Fodera BT Pre
Schaller Bridge & Hipshot Tuners D Tuner on the E String

Second One Is:
Alder Body Quilted Maple Top
Maple Neck Brazilian Rosewood Unlined
Fralin Pickups With Fodera BT Pre and Passive Tone Control
Fodera Bridge & Hipshot Tuners D Tuner on the E String
